Responsibilities
This individual will be responsible for the planning and stand-up creation of targeted emerging strategies across the enterprise, inclusive of building structure, financial plan, securing funding and establishing market performance objectives for achievement of the business vision and goals. Once established, successful initiatives can be assimilated into the overall business structure. Improves business concepts and operational plans and incorporates opportunities to engage partners and key stakeholders. Creates financial plans and ensures funding. Responsible for collaborating and key partnerships with an interdisciplinary team of Chief Executives as well as the American Heart Association Board and volunteer leaders.
Establishes the vision and creates an organizational plan for new business or initiatives including legal structure, governance model, funding sources and staffing.
Collaborates and consults with C-suite on business impact, achievement of milestones, and strategic plans. Develop long-term strategies for organizational alignment of post-pilot initiatives.
Collaborates with Mission Advancement and Corporate Relations to secure funding for emerging strategies.
Develops business or initiative roadmap, communication and marketing plan for overall business concept and product development. Designs product structure, market strategy and development plan for introduction and launch of business or initiative.
Leads implementation of operational plan as needed including hiring, developing and motivating key leadership roles to execute and manage business, partnerships, and market penetration.
Develops models for partnerships and key stakeholder involvement to maximize success.
There are two projects initially envisioned: International Professional Education Hub and AI Validation Lab.
Qualifications
Bachelor's degree or equivalent work experience.
Eight (8) years of work-related experience.
Compensation & Benefits
The salary minimum to the midpoint of the range is $175,000.00 to $233,400.00 This position is incentive eligible up to 22% based on achieving specific targets. Pay is commensurate with experience; geographic differences may apply to the pay range. The American Heart Association reserves the right to pay more or less than the posted range.
